#95a768 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#95a768 is composed of 58.4% red, 65.5% green and 40.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 37.7% yellow and 34.5% black. It has a hue angle of 77.1 degrees, a saturation of 26.4% and a lightness of 53.1%. #95a768 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ffd0 with #2b4f00. Closest websafe color is: #999966.

#95a768 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#95a768 has RGB values of R:149, G:167, B:104 and CMYK values of C:0.11, M:0, Y:0.38,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 9807720.

Hex triplet 95a768 #95a768
RGB Decimal 149, 167, 104 rgb(149,167,104)
RGB Percent 58.4, 65.5, 40.8 rgb(58.4%,65.5%,40.8%)
CMYK 11, 0, 38, 35
HSL 77.1°, 26.4, 53.1 hsl(77.1,26.4%,53.1%)
HSV (or HSB) 77.1°, 37.7, 65.5
Web Safe 999966 #999966
CIE-LAB 65.769, -16.967, 30.52
XYZ 28.711, 35.026, 18.344
xyY 0.35, 0.427, 35.026
CIE-LCH 65.769, 34.92, 119.071
CIE-LUV 65.769, -7.954, 42.046
Hunter-Lab 59.183, -16.975, 23.051
Binary 10010101, 10100111, 01101000

Shades and Tints of #95a768

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090a06 is the darkest color, while #fdfef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#95a768

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#898b84 is the less saturated color, while #b8fa15 is the most saturated one.
